Distance From Baneasa Airport to Peretola Airport (BBU - FLR Distance)
The flight distance from Baneasa Airport (BBU) to Peretola Airport (FLR) is 739 miles. This is equivalent to 1190 kilometers or 642 nautical miles. The distance shown below is the straight line distance (may be called as flying or air distance) or direct flight distance between airports.
1190 kilometers is the distance from Baneasa Airport, Romania to Peretola Airport, Italy.
Flight Duration between Bucharest, Romania and Florence, Italy
Estimated flight time from Baneasa Airport, Bucharest, Romania to Peretola Airport, Florence, Italy is 1 hours 28 minutes under avarage conditions. The flight time calculator assumes an average flight speed for a commercial airliner of 500 mph, which is equivalent to 805 km/hr or 434 knots. Your actual flying time may vary depending on wind speeds or weather conditions.
